Factors to Consider When Choosing Best Text Art Tools
Choosing the best text art tools involves understanding your craft focus—whether detailed embossing, versatile dotting, or precise lettering. Key considerations include the type of project, ease of use, durability, and whether portability or multiple sizes are priorities. I’ve structured this guide to help you match your specific needs with the right tool, balancing features and tradeoffs to find your perfect match.Types of Text Art Tools
Tools for text art range from styluses and dotting tools to stencils and stamps. Styluses excel at embossing and detailed line work, making them ideal for intricate designs. Dotting tools are perfect for creating uniform dots and textured patterns across a variety of surfaces. Stencils and stamps bring speed and consistency to lettering, especially useful for signage or repetitive decoration. Your choice depends on the craft style and the level of precision required.
Material and Durability
Look for tools made from sturdy materials like stainless steel or high-quality plastic. These materials ensure longevity, especially when used frequently or with tougher surfaces. Lightweight options are better for extended sessions, but they might sacrifice some durability. Conversely, heavier tools may provide more control but could cause fatigue over time.
Size and Ergonomics
Size matters for comfort and precision. Smaller tips or stamps are best for fine details, while larger tools suit broader strokes or filling larger areas. Ergonomic handles or grips reduce fatigue and improve control, especially for long projects. Consider how the tool feels in your hand and whether it matches your typical project scale.
Application and Compatibility
Ensure the tool is suitable for your primary craft material—clay, rock, wood, or fabric. Some tools, like embossing styluses, are versatile, while others, like specific dotting tools, are better for particular surfaces. Compatibility with your project size and surface type will influence your overall satisfaction and results.
